diff --git a/.nojekyll b/.nojekyll new file mode 100644 index 000000000..e69de29bb diff --git a/404.html b/404.html new file mode 100644 index 000000000..74d6b361e --- /dev/null +++ b/404.html @@ -0,0 +1,8957 @@ + + + +
+ + + + + + + + + + + + + + +去中心化应用程序 (dApp) 是一种可以通过使用在区块链上运行的智能合约自主运行的应用程序。 与传统应用程序一样,dApp 为其用户提供一些功能或实用程序。
+
+
+
访问以下链接以了解更多相关信息
dApp 简介
+Introduction to dApps
+什么是 Dapp? 去中心化应用解释
+What Is a Dapp? Decentralized Apps Explained
与 Web2 应用程序不同,在 Web3 中没有存储应用程序状态或用户身份的集中式数据库,也没有后端逻辑所在的集中式 Web 服务器。
+
+
+
访问以下链接以了解更多相关信息
Web 3.0 应用程序的架构
+The Architecture of a Web 3.0 application
+去中心化应用架构:后端、安全和设计模式
+Decentralized Applications Architecture: Back End, Security and Design Patterns
+区块链开发:Dapp 架构
+Blockchain Development: Dapp Architecture
Angular 是一个基于组件的前端开发框架,它建立在 TypeScript 之上,它包含一组集成良好的库,其中包括路由、表单管理、客户端-服务器通信等功能。
+
+
+
访问以下链接以了解更多相关信息
访问专用 Angular 路线图
+Visit Dedicated Angular Roadmap
+官方 - Angular 入门
+Official - Getting started with Angular
React 是用于构建用户界面的最流行的前端 JavaScript 库。 React 还可以使用 Node 在服务器上呈现,并使用 React Native 为移动应用程序提供支持。
+
+
+
访问以下链接以了解更多相关信息
访问 React 路线图
+Visit Dedicated React Roadmap
+React Website
+官方入门
+Official Getting Started
+React 初学者指南
+The Beginners Guide to React
+React JS 初学者课程
+React JS Course for Beginners
+React 课程 - React JavaScript 库初学者教程 [2022]
+React Course - Beginners Tutorial for React JavaScript Library [2022]
+了解 Reacts UI 渲染过程
+Understanding Reacts UI Rendering Process
Web 框架旨在编写 Web 应用程序。 框架是帮助开发软件产品或网站的库的集合。 用于 Web 应用程序开发的框架是各种工具的集合。 框架的能力和功能各不相同,具体取决于任务集。 他们定义结构,建立规则,并提供所需的开发工具。
+
+
+
访问以下链接以了解更多相关信息
Web3 前端——你需要了解的关于构建 Dapp 前端的一切
+Web3 Frontend – Everything You Need to Learn About Building Dapp Frontends
+框架和库有什么区别?
+What is the difference between a framework and a library?
+哪个 JS 框架最好?
+Which JS Framework is best?
Vue.js 是一个用于构建用户界面和单页应用程序的开源 JavaScript 框架。 它主要专注于前端开发。
+
+
+
访问以下链接以了解更多相关信息
访问专用 Vue 路线图
+Visit Dedicated Vue Roadmap
+Vue.js Website
+官方入门
+Official Getting Started
+Vue.js 初学者课程
+Vue.js Course for Beginners
+Vue.js 速成班
+Vue.js Crash Course
dApp 在不可变的区块链上运行时面临着独特的安全挑战。 dApp 更难维护,开发人员一旦部署就无法修改或更新他们的代码。 因此,在将其上链之前必须特别考虑。
+
+
+
访问以下链接以了解更多相关信息
dAPP 安全标准
+DAPP Security Standards
+dApp 安全注意事项
+dApp Security Considerations
+dApp 安全:所有你需要知道的
+dApp Security:All You Need to Know
您不需要从头开始编写项目中的每个智能合约。 有许多可用的开源智能合约库可以为您的项目提供可重复使用的构建块,从而使您不必重新发明轮子。
+ethers.js 库旨在成为一个完整而紧凑的库,用于与以太坊区块链及其生态系统进行交互。 它最初是为与 ethers.io 一起使用而设计的,后来扩展为一个更通用的库。
web3.js 是一组库,允许您使用 HTTP、IPC 或 WebSocket 与本地或远程以太坊节点进行交互。
一个库,可让您从 JavaScript 应用程序访问强大的 Moralis Server 后端。
区块链是计算机(称为节点)的分布式网络,运行可以验证块和交易数据的软件。 该软件应用程序称为客户端,必须在您的计算机上运行才能将其变成区块链节点。
+Go Ethereum (Geth) 是以太坊协议的三个原始实现(以及 C++ 和 Python)之一。 它是用 Go 编写的,完全开源,并在 GNU LGPL v3 下获得许可。
+Besu 是一个 Apache 2.0 许可的、主网兼容的、用 Java 编写的以太坊客户端。
+Nethermind 是一个高性能、高度可配置的完整以太坊协议客户端,它基于 .NET 构建,可在 Linux、Windows 和 macOS 上运行,并支持 Clique、Aura、Ethash 和 Proof-of-Stake 共识算法。
+Substrate 是一个软件开发工具包 (SDK),专门设计用于为您提供区块链所需的所有基本组件,因此您可以专注于打造使您的链独一无二和创新的逻辑。
+构建一个成熟的 dapp 需要不同的技术。 软件框架包括许多所需的功能或提供简单的插件系统来选择您想要的工具。
+Hardhat 是一个以太坊开发环境。 它允许用户编译合约并在开发网络上运行它们。 获取 Solidity 堆栈跟踪、console.log 等。
+Hardhat Overview
+Build and Deploy Smart Contracts using Hardhat
+Brownie 是一个基于 Python 的开发和测试框架,用于针对以太坊虚拟机的智能合约。
+Brownie Overview
+Python and Blockchain: Deploy Smart Contracts using Brownie
+使用以太坊虚拟机 (EVM) 的区块链开发环境、测试框架和资产管道,旨在让开发人员的生活更轻松。
+Truffle Overview
+Truffle Tutorial for Beginners | Compile, Test & Deploy Smart contracts to any EVM Blockchain
+官网显示该词条:null
+
+
+
访问以下链接以了解更多相关信息
dApp 开发框架
+dApp Development Frameworks
+以太坊开发者工具的权威列表 - 框架
+A Definitive List of Ethereum Developer Tools - Frameworks
+2022 年您需要的 10 大智能合约开发工具
+Top 10 Smart Contract Developer Tools You Need for 2022
构建满足需求且没有缺陷的软件的关键是测试。 软件测试帮助开发人员知道他们正在构建正确的软件。 当测试作为开发过程的一部分运行时(通常使用持续集成工具),它们可以建立信心并防止代码回归。与传统软件一样,测试 dApp 涉及测试构成 dApp 的整个堆栈(后端、前端、数据库等)。
+
+
+
访问以下链接以了解更多相关信息
什么是软件测试?
+What is Software Testing?
+测试Pyramid
+Testing Pyramid
+如何测试 dApp(去中心化应用程序)
+How to test dApps (decentralized applications)
dApps 可能更难维护,因为发布到区块链的代码和数据更难修改。 一旦部署了 dapp(或 dapp 存储的底层数据),开发人员就很难对其进行更新,即使在旧版本中发现了错误或安全风险。
+ + + + + + + + + + + + + +运行您自己的区块链节点可能具有挑战性,尤其是在开始或快速扩展时。 有许多服务可以为您运行优化的节点基础设施,因此您可以专注于开发您的应用程序或产品。
+Alchemy 是一个开发者平台,它使公司能够构建可扩展且可靠的去中心化应用程序,而无需在内部管理区块链基础设施。
+Alchemy official site
Infura 提供的工具和基础设施使开发人员能够轻松地将他们的区块链应用程序从测试阶段转移到规模化部署阶段——通过对以太坊和 IPFS 的简单、可靠的访问。
+Infura official site
Moralis 提供用于构建高性能 dapp 的单一工作流程。 与您最喜欢的 web3 工具和服务完全兼容。
+Moralis official site
QuickNode 是一个用于构建和扩展区块链应用程序的 Web3 开发人员平台。
+Quicknode official site
+
+
访问以下链接以了解更多相关信息
区块链节点提供商及其工作方式
+Blockchain Node Providers and How They Work
+节点即服务 - 以太坊
+Node as a Service - Ethereum
去中心化自治组织 (DAO) 是一种新兴的法律结构形式。 由于没有中央管理机构,DAO 中的每个成员通常都有一个共同的目标,并试图以实体的最佳利益行事。 通过加密货币爱好者和区块链技术得到普及,DAO 用于以自下而上的管理方法做出决策。
+
+
+
访问以下链接以了解更多相关信息
什么是 DAO,它们是如何工作的?
+What Is A DAO And How Do They Work?
+去中心化自治组织 (DAO)
+Decentralized Autonomous Organization (DAO)
不可替代令牌 (NFT) 是一种金融证券,由存储在区块链(一种分布式账本形式)中的数字数据组成。 NFT 的所有权记录在区块链中,所有者可以转让,允许 NFT 出售和交易。
+
+
+
访问以下链接以了解更多相关信息
不可替代代币 (NFT)
+Non-Fungible Token (NFT)
+NFT,解释
+NFTs, explained
+5 分钟解释 NFT | 什么是 NFT? - 不可替代令牌
+NFT Explained In 5 Minutes | What Is NFT? - Non Fungible Token
dApps 几乎可以用于任何需要两方或多方就某事达成一致的事情。 当满足适当的条件时,智能合约将自动执行。 一个重要的区别是这些交易不再基于信任,而是基于加密支持的智能合约。
+
+
+
访问以下链接以了解更多相关信息
什么是 dApp? 去中心化应用指南
+What Is a dApp? A Guide to Decentralized Applications
+区块链用例和行业应用
+Blockchain Use Cases and Applications by Industry
+区块链技术的真实用例
+The real-world use cases for blockchain technology
区块链技术能够消除中心化组织在转移支付时收取的所有通行费。
+
+
+
访问以下链接以了解更多相关信息
区块链如何影响全球支付和汇款?
+How does blockchain impact global payments and remittances?
+智能合约用例——支付
+Smart Contract Use Cases - Payments
区块链技术能够通过使用预言机验证真实世界的数据来自动化索赔功能。 它还使各方之间的索赔支付自动化,从而降低保险公司的管理成本。
+
+
+
访问以下链接以了解更多相关信息
智能合约用例 - 保险
+Smart Contract Use Cases - Insurance
+保险业区块链的 7 大用例
+Top 7 Use Cases of Blockchain in the Insurance Industry
去中心化金融通过使用区块链上的智能合约提供金融工具,而不依赖于经纪、交易所或银行等中介机构。
+
+
+
访问以下链接以了解更多相关信息
去中心化金融(DeFi)定义
+Decentralized Finance (DeFi) Definition
+什么是去中心化金融(DeFi)?
+What is DeFi?
+什么是去中心化金融(DeFi)? (去中心化金融动画)
+What is DeFi? (Decentralized Finance Animated)
部署 dApp 涉及部署其所有层,通常通过管理框架进行部署。
+
+
+
访问以下链接以了解更多相关信息
使用集成 Web3 监控构建以太坊 DApp 的教程
+Tutorial for building an Ethereum DApp with Integrated Web3 Monitoring
+构建和部署现代 Web 3.0 区块链应用程序
+Build and Deploy a Modern Web 3.0 Blockchain App
Chainlink 是一个去中心化的预言机网络,它使智能合约能够安全地与存在于区块链网络之外的真实世界数据和服务进行交互。
+
+
+
访问以下链接以了解更多相关信息
什么是Chainlink? 初学者指南
+What Is Chainlink? A Beginner’s Guide.
+5 分钟了解 Chainlink
+What Is Chainlink in 5 Minutes
通过利用许多不同的数据源,并实施不受单个实体控制的预言机系统,去中心化的预言机网络为智能合约提供了更高级别的安全性和公平性。
+访问以下链接以了解更多相关信息
分散的 Oracle 网络
+Decentralized Oracle Networks
+去中心化 Oracle 网络发展的新手指南
+A Beginner’s Guide To The Evolution Of Decentralized Oracle Networks
+了解Oracle 网络
+Understanding Oracle Networks
区块链预言机是一种将智能合约与外部世界连接起来的第三方服务,主要是从外部世界输入信息,但也可以反过来。 来自世界的信息封装了多个来源,以便获得分散的知识。
+
+
+
访问以下链接以了解更多相关信息
+区块链预言机
+Blockchain Oracle
+什么是区块链预言机?
+What Is a Blockchain Oracle?
混合智能合约将区块链(链上)上运行的代码与去中心化 Oracle 网络提供的区块链外部(链下)的数据和计算相结合。
+
+
+
访问以下链接以了解更多相关信息
混合智能合约解释
+Hybrid Smart Contracts Explained
+了解混合智能合约的完整指南
+A complete guide to understand hybrid smart contracts
由于区块链和加密货币的兴起,Web3 相关的活动逐渐增多。以下是一些Web3相关的活动:
+这个峰会通常由区块链技术公司和机构组织,旨在推广区块链技术的应用和发展。
+由Web3 基金会主办的技术大会,旨在促进去中心化、开放的Web生态系统的发展。
+以太坊社区的开发者大会,旨在促进以太坊应用程序的发展。
+由CoinDesk主办的全球性区块链峰会,汇聚了全球最具影响力的区块链和加密货币从业者,探讨区块链和加密货币的未来趋势。
+由NFT行业领导者主办的专业活动,旨在推动NFT的发展和技术创新。
+纽约举办的全球顶级区块链峰会之一,聚集了来自世界各地的区块链从业者和企业家。
+由Parity Technologies主办的技术会议,重点讨论去中心化应用程序和Web3 技术。
+由Cryptocurrency投资者组织的峰会,探讨数字资产投资的前沿发展趋势。
+由以太坊社区主办的去中心化应用程序大会,展示和推广去中心化应用程序的创新和发展。
+黑客松通常是以技术和创新为主题的聚会或讲座,旨在推广和分享最新和最有前途的技术和思想,特别是与互联网、人工智能、大数据和区块链等领域相关的内容。极客松活动有时也会提供机会让与会者互动交流、创意碰撞,可能会有一些有趣的技术实践或者创业项目介绍等等。
+这些活动和峰会提供了一个了解Web3 技术、加密货币和数字资产领域最新动态的途径。
+ + + + + + + + + + + + + +